What is Low Blood Pressure?
Blood pressure (BP) is the amount of force exerted on the walls of the arteries through circulating blood in one’s system. It is typically expressed as two numbers: the systolic blood pressure which is the higher of the two numbers, this is the pressure in the arteries when the heart is contracting and the diastolic blood pressure which is the lower of the two numbers, this is the pressure when the heart is relaxed.
The normal blood pressure as recommended by the American Heart Association is a systolic pressure of below 120mmHg and a diastolic pressure below 80mmHg. Hypotension normally has features of systolic blood pressure below 90mmHg and diastolic blood pressure below 60mmHg. However, these guidelines are read along with age, health status of the person, and other conditions.
Causes of Low Blood Pressure
Low BP can have a wide range of underlying causes, including both physiological and pathological factors. Understanding the potential causes is crucial for identifying the appropriate treatment approach.
Physiological Causes
- Age: This is probably due to the fact that the blood vessels may gradually lose their elasticity as persons age. This decreases in blood pressure.
- Pregnancy: During pregnancy, certain hormones cause changes in the circulatory system, and blood pressure may decrease with pregnancy. This happens especially early pregnancy.
- Dehydration: Sweating, diarrhea and vomiting are some of the causes that might result to fluid loss, causing low BP.
- Prolonged Bed Rest: The condition of bed rest, for example during a hospital stay, or after a surgery operation, reduces blood pressure.
Pathological Causes
- Medications: Some of these drugs include diuretic drugs, antidepressants, and blood pressure reducing drugs are others that may cause low blood pressure.
- Underlying Medical Conditions: Some of these include diabetes, Addison’s disease, anemia and heart diseases whether they are heart failure, or congenital heart defects.
- Neurological Disorders: Essentials of the autonomic nervous system such as Parkinson’s disease multiple sclerosis, Guillain-Barré syndrome, and others may lead to complications affecting the fluids pressure control systems.
- Severe Infections: Septicemia that results from an infection can lower blood pressure considerably because inflammation has taken place and blood vessels have dilated.
- Severe Allergic Reactions: Anaphylaxis is a severe and potentially fatal allergic reaction. It is one of the causes of a rapid reduction in blood pressure.
Symptoms of Low BP
The signs of low BP differ. From unequivocal to subtle and may include a grave danger to the life of the patient. It is useful to recall the signs and symptoms, which should be a wakeup call for a doctor’s visit.
Mild Symptoms
- Dizziness or lightheadedness: Dizziness is among the most frequent signs of low BP. Especially when a person gets up or changes the position of the body in some way.
- Fatigue or weakness: Less delivery of oxygen and nutrients to body tissues resulting into fatigue and less energy
- Blurred vision: This state of the eyes may lead to some forms of vision deficiencies which are however usually not permanent.
- Nausea or vomiting: Hypotension tends to regress the normal proper functioning of the gastrointestinal tract thereby causing nausea or vomiting.
- Headaches: Cerebral circulation is the blood supply of the brain and reduced supply may cause headaches.
Severe Symptoms
- Fainting or syncope: Sometimes the low BP can result to a sudden passing out which is termed syncope or fainting.
- Shock: Sudden or significant falls in blood pressure may cause a critical state termed as shock or fainting. It relates to rapid and feeble pulse, waxy pallor, confusion and so on.
- Organ Damage: The low BP may lead to less supply of blood to the kidneys, liver, or the heart.

Diagnosing Low Blood Pressure
The diagnosis of low blood pressure typically involves a comprehensive medical evaluation, including:
- BP Measurement: Sphygmomanometer is used to check the BP. It is done both when seated or laying, then standing in a bid to identify drastic changes.
- Medical History: Symptoms, medication, and any illnesses or other factors helps to diagnose the root causes of the condition.
- Physical Examination: A physical check-up which focuses on cardiovascular, neurological, and endocrinal manifestations of the disease could offer clues regarding the basis of low BP.
- Laboratory Tests: A number of screening lab tests help determine how internal processes of the body are functioning, like anemia, thyroid issues, or kidney issues.
- Imaging Studies: Sometimes, doctors may suggest for an echocardiogram or a computed tomography (CT) scan. This helps to examine the architecture and functioning of the heart and blood vessels.

Medication Management
In some cases, healthcare providers may prescribe medications to help manage low blood pressure, such as:
- Fludrocortisone: This synthesized hormone can be of help in cases where one requires adjustment or augmentation of blood volume and pressure.
- Midodrine: This alpha-adrenergic agonist might have the capacity to constrict tiny blood vessels, leading to an increase in blood pressure.
- Droxidopa: This drug may also facilitate the enhanced synthesis of norepinephrine in the body. It is commonly associated with blood pressure regulation.
